Take a trip up to Katoomba in the blue mountains. There's several climbing shops there who can point you in the right direction. Is Colo just north of Richmond? If it is then the blue mountains are right on your doorstep. Heaps to do.

Best Areas in the moutains are places like Diamond Falls, Centennial Glen, Boronia Point. This should help:
